Van Buren Elementary School

169 Main Street Suite 101
Van Buren, ME 04785

Serving 206 students in grades Prekindergarten-8, Van Buren Elementary School ranks in the bottom 50% of all schools in Maine for overall test scores (math proficiency is bottom 50%, and reading proficiency is bottom 50%).
The percentage of students achieving proficiency in math is 35-39% (which is lower than the Maine state average of 49%). The percentage of students achieving proficiency in reading/language arts is 85-89% (which is higher than the Maine state average of 84%).
The student-teacher ratio of 15:1 is higher than the Maine state level of 11:1.
Minority enrollment is 8% of the student body (majority Black), which is lower than the Maine state average of 14% (majority Black).
